AMF applies ESMA guidelines on ETFs and other UCITS issues

The Autorité des Marchés Financiers has adopted guidelines issued by the European Securities and Markets Authority on exchange-traded funds and other issues related to Undertakings for Collective Investment in Transferable Securities.


Based on the UCITS Directive (2009/65/EC), the ESMA guidelines explain how European legislation is to be applied in particular to the management of UCITS compliant with Directive 2009/65/EC.

The guidelines have been incorporated into the AMF's position and give details concerning:

  • the information to be supplied to investors about index funds and ETFs;
  • the special rules that UCITS have to apply if they use over-the-counter derivatives and efficient portfolio management techniques;
  • the criteria for financial indices in which UCITS invest;
  • implementation deadlines, particularly for existing UCITS.
